Facebook, Walmart, and Disney have been accused of violating four patent technologies of Eolas Technologies and the Regents of the University of California. The patent infringement trial consists of four interactive technology violations, including hypermedia display and interaction. 

This is not the first time Texas-based Eolas has sued major companies for patent infringement. This past February, Eolas lost a trial in Texas against Amazon, Google, and Yahoo for two of the same patents. How Eolas has been able to pursue a case for the same patents is questionable. However, in 2007, Eolas did settle for an undisclosed amount against Microsoft on a different patent litigation. 

Facebook feels this case comes without merit and in a statement a spokesperson said, "We will fight it vigorously."
